What is Immersity AI?

Immersity AI is a platform that allows users to convert 2D images and videos into 3D experiences. The core functionality of this tool is its ability to generate depth in digital media, thereby transforming flat visuals into immersive content. The platform enables the conversion of 2D images into 3D motion, facilitating the addition of an extra depth dimension to the provided content. Coupled with full control over camera path and instant previews prior to conversion, it allows for a high degree of customization.In addition to image conversion, users can convert videos into a more immersive 3D experience, suitable for viewing on any XR device. This is facilitated by detailed, multi-layered depth maps that add a heightened sense of realism to videos in 3D. The platform also offers unrivalled depth mapping for image conversion, producing accurately detailed 3D images. All forms of conversion on Immersity AI utilize the Neural Depth Engine, a technology that generates depth maps with high precision and speed. This engine works based on a comprehensive dataset of millions of 3D images, yielding a nuanced depth creation that contributes to precise conversions. Alongside accuracy and speed, the Neural Depth Engine also offers an easy preview option, full camera control, and predictability in its performance. As a result, it is favored by many content creators across various disciplines. Immersity AI can be used across all platforms that support XR, disparity mapping, depth, and motion editing.
